Show Info
Genre(s): Reality (Competitive)
First Air Date: June 18, 2006
Summary
Starring Laird Macintosh (host)
Ten teams of three travel around the country in search of clues that lead to a "hidden treasure" in this Amazing Race-esque (in concept, not in execution) reality competition.

What The Critics Said
All critic scores are converted to a 100-point scale. If a critic does not indicate a score, we assign a score based on the general impression given by the text of the review. Learn more...
Miami HeraldGlenn Garvin
Just think of all the stolen ideas as a public works program for Hollywood lawyers and stick to the action on-screen, which is quite entertaining.
Read Full Review >People WeeklyTom Gliatto
[Viewers] may get a kick out of the mix of adrenaline and murk. [26 Jun 2006, p.41]
Los Angeles TimesRobert Lloyd
An ideal summer entertainment for armchair travelers.
Read Full Review >Entertainment WeeklyWhitney Pastorek
It's just an Amazing Race knockoff. [16 Jun 2006, p.72]
New York PostLinda Stasi
The format is so complicated and the contestants so unappealing that the show misses the mark.
Read Full Review >SalonHeather Havrilesky
If you've only watched a few episodes of ["The Amazing Race"] but never really appreciated its ability to amaze, tune in for an episode of "Treasure Hunters" and you'll begin to understand just how high "TAR" has set the bar.
Read Full Review >Chicago Sun-TimesDoug Elfman
The problem with "Treasure Hunters" is the same problem with "Amazing Race": It just feels like all the competing teams are spinning their wheels by solving clues.
Read Full Review >Hollywood ReporterBarry Garron
It is obvious in just the first few minutes who the real winners are -- members of the NBC sales department. Collectively, they have taken product placement to new and annoying heights.
Read Full Review >The New York TimesVirginia Heffernan
"Treasure Hunters" is too flimsy a pillar to help structure NBC's reality-television future.
Read Full Review >Boston GlobeMatthew Gilbert
"Treasure Hunters" is slickly annoying right off the bat.
Read Full Review >NewsdayVerne Gay
Because so many viewers will have seen this kind of reality show before, their minds may start to wander by the second commercial break.
Read Full Review >Pittsburgh Post-GazetteRob Owen
Dull and plodding, "Hunters" is no reality TV treasure.
Read Full Review >VarietyBrian Lowry
The racing around adds up to a chaotic bore without a hint of originality, as well as the most confusing set of rules for a reality show since the first season of "The Mole."
